AI Summary

  • Creates separate criminal penalties for possession of less than 4 ounces of Schedule VI controlled substances, treating them differently from other controlled substances under Arkansas Code § 5-64-401(c).

  • Establishes possession of less than 4 ounces of Schedule VI controlled substance as a Class A misdemeanor for first offense, Class D felony for second offense, and Class C felony for third or subsequent offense.

  • Increases the marijuana threshold for rebuttable presumption of intent to deliver from 1 ounce to 4 ounces under Arkansas Code § 5-64-401(d)(3)(A)(vii).

  • Adds new section 5-64-419 establishing graduated penalties for Schedule VI controlled substance possession, with persons possessing 4 ounces or more prosecuted under standard controlled substance laws.

  • Imposes $300 court costs for knowingly possessing less than 4 ounces of Schedule VI controlled substance, with $200 of collected costs directed to the Drug Abuse Prevention and Treatment Fund for the Office of Alcohol and Drug Abuse Prevention.

Legislative Description

To Establish Criminal Penalties For The Possession Of Less Than Four Ounces Of A Schedule Vi Controlled Substance.
